The Multicast Admin Boundary Configuration page contains the following fields:

Group — Select Create Boundary from the drop-down menu to create a new admin scope boundary,

or select one of the existing boundary specifications to display or update its configuration.

Interface — Select the router interface for which the administratively scoped boundary is to be

configured.

Group IP — Enter the multicast group address for the start of the range of addresses to be excluded.

The address must be in the range of 239.0.0.0 through 239.255.255.255.

Group Mask — Enter the mask to be applied to the multicast group address. The combination of the

mask and the Group IP gives the range of administratively scoped addresses for the selected interface.

Configuring an Admin Boundary

1. Open the Multicast Admin Boundary Configuration

page.

2. Select Create Boundary in the Group IP field to configure a new admin scope boundary, or select one

of the existing entries.

3. Modify the remaining fields as needed.
4. Click Apply Changes.

The new or modified admin scope boundary is saved, and the device is updated.
